Vertex Operators and Scattering Amplitudes of the Bosonic Open String Theory in the Linear Dilaton Background

The operator formalism of the first quantized string theory is applied to the stringy excitations in the linear dilaton background. In particular, the normal-ordered vertex operators in the old-covariant spectrum of the bosonic open string, which correspond to the physical state solutions of the Virasoro constraints, are shown to satisfy the conformal algebra. Tree-level scattering amplitudes among different stringy states are computed using the coherent-state method and the modified inner product of the Hilbert space. Decoupling of the zero-norm states, i.e., the on-shell stringy Ward identities are shown to hold for all tree-level amplitudes under consideration.
